
Head-to-head
Medion Erazer Scout 17 E1 vs Razer Blade 16 2025 RTX
Razer Blade 16 2025 RTX is the faster machine, averaging 21% more frames across 7 games. We haven't confirmed a UK price for both machines, so treat this as a performance comparison rather than a value one.
Frame rates, side by side
| Game | Medion Erazer Scout 17 E1 | Razer Blade 16 2025 RTX | Diff |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baldur's Gate 3 | 87 | 164 | -77 |
| Cyberpunk 2077 | 88 | 118 | -30 |
| Dota 2 | 131 | 143 | -12 |
| Final Fantasy XV | 102 | 147 | -45 |
| GTA V | 170 | 122 | +48 |
| Strange Brigade | 220 | 322 | -102 |
| X-Plane 11 | 77 | 85 | -8 |
1920×1080, High preset, upscaling off. Source: Notebookcheck.

How these numbers were produced
Frame rates here are not measured by us, and we label how each one was arrived at. A figure marked measured comes from a published run on that exact machine. A figure marked representative is derived from the GPU and its power limit (TGP) and cross-referenced against published reviews - a sound estimate of what that configuration delivers, but not a measurement of that specific laptop. Unless stated otherwise, numbers are 1920x1080, High preset, upscaling off. Where a laptop ships in several power configurations we use the wattage of the exact SKU listed, because a 140W RTX 5070 and a 115W one are not the same product.
